Warning Signs You Need Stucco Water Damage Repair
Catching water damage early can save you money and prevent bigger problems. Look out for these warning signs:
Musty Odors That Won't Go Away
Strong, persistent musty odors can show mold growth, which can lead to serious health issues. If you notice these odors, don't ignore them, call our team for a thorough inspection and repair.
Don't ignore musty odors call for an inspection and get rid of the mold.
Water Stains on Your Walls
Water stains on your stucco exterior can be a sign of water damage. If you notice these stains, call our team to assess and repair the damage before it's too late.
Water stains are a warning sign call for an inspection and get the repair done.
Warped or Cracked Stucco
Warped or cracked stucco can be a sign of structural damage. If you notice these issues, don't delay, call our team for a thorough inspection and repair.

Stucco Water Damage Repair v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Water damage on a small area (less than 10 sq. Ft.) | Yes | No | You can handle small areas yourself with the right equipment and knowledge. |
| Water damage on a large area (more than 10 sq. Ft.) | No | Yes | Large areas need specialized equipment and expertise to prevent further damage and ensure a safe environment. |
| Water damage with standing water (more than 1 inch deep) | No | Yes | Standing water can lead to mold growth and structural damage, needing professional intervention to rectify the situation. |
| Water damage with structural damage (cracks in walls, etc.) | No | Yes | Structural damage needs professional assessment and repair to ensure the integrity of your home's structure. |
